Budget, in US dollars

Steps of $500. $1,000 is the least that buys every part a coding & development PC needs; past $8,500 the catalogue has nothing faster to add. A screen, keyboard and mouse come on top.

How it should look

Every part black, and nothing in the box lights up. The case, the cooler, the board, the card, the supply and the memory follow the colour; the case's fans, the cooler, the board and the memory follow the lighting. A drive has no colour and a supply does not glow, so neither is asked to match. A look costs money, so the budget rail moves with it.

$1,500 for coding & development

Tuned for cores for builds and containers, plenty of memory, fast storage, and a card for several screens or a local model.

$1,499 for 8 parts, $1 under budget

The Intel Core i7-14700K has headroom to spare. The Radeon RX 6600 sets the frame rate at 1440p, so a faster card is the upgrade that shows.
